How We Restore Your Floor: A Step-by-Step Guide
The key to successful floor water damage restoration lies in our meticulous process. We’ll work with you every step of the way to ensure you understand what’s happening and what to expect. No surprises here.
Step 1: Inspection and Assessment
Our certified technicians will inspect your property to identify the source and extent of the damage. We’ll take note of any affected areas, including water-damaged flooring, walls, and structural parts. This is where the magic happens.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use our powerful vacuum units to extract water from your property, reducing the risk of further damage and preventing mold growth. This is a critical step in preventing secondary damage.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Our team will use industrial-grade dehumidifiers to remove excess moisture from your property, ensuring a safe and healthy environment for you and your family. This is where the real work begins.
Step 4: Disinfecting and Sanitizing
We’ll use hospital-grade disinfectants to remove any bacteria, viruses, or fungi that may have taken hold in your property. This is crucial in preventing the spread of diseases and ensuring your home is safe to occupy.
Step 5: Reconstruction and Repair
Once your property is dry and safe, our skilled technicians will begin the reconstruction process, repairing any damaged flooring, walls, or structural parts. You’ll love the end result.

Warning Signs You Need Floor Water Damage Restoration ASAP
Don’t wait until it’s too late, catch these warning signs early to prevent further damage and costly repairs.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
That unmistakable smell is a sign of moisture and potential mold growth. Don’t ignore it it’s a ticking time bomb for your home’s integrity.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Water damage can cause your flooring to warp or buckle, creating a hazard for you and your family. Don’t wait to fix it it’s only going to get worse.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Water damage can cause paint or wallpaper to peel, revealing unsightly stains and damage. Address it now to prevent further damage and costly repairs.
Discolored or Stained Ceilings
Water damage can cause discoloration or staining on your ceilings, which can be a sign of a larger issue. Don’t ignore it it’s only going to get worse.
Structural Damage or Sagging
Water damage can cause structural parts to weaken or sag, creating a safety hazard for you and your family. Address it now to prevent further damage and costly repairs.
Visible Water Stains
Water stains on your walls or ceilings are a clear indication of water damage. Don’t ignore it act fast to prevent further damage and costly repairs.

Floor Water Damage Restoration Cost in Kent, WA
The cost of floor water damage restoration in Kent, WA,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. These are estimates, not guarantees.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, number of damaged rooms |
| Disinfecting and sanitizing | $200 – $1,000 | Severity of contamination, number of affected surfaces |
| Reconstruction and repair | $1,000 – $5,000 | Complexity of repairs, number of damaged structural parts |
| Equipment rental and labor | $500 – $2,000 | Number of days required for drying, complexity of equipment needed |
| More services (insurance claims, permits) | $200 – $1,000 | Nature of more services required, complexity of paperwork involved |
